Solution Overview

Problem

Existing sheet punching devices either lack accuracy due to involute curve shapes causing clearance issues or suffer from low efficiency as they require temporary cessation of sheet conveyance to punch holes accurately.

Innovation Solution

A sheet punching device that rotates a die and moves a punch in and out of the die hole in synchronization, allowing for accurate and efficient hole punching without stopping sheet conveyance, using a mechanism involving a reciprocating punch holder and cam system to maintain alignment and prevent galling.

AI summary

A sheet punching device including: a die which has a die hole and is configured to be driven to rotate; a punch configured to move in and out of the die hole to punch a hole in a sheet; and a punch operating unit configured to reciprocate the punch with respect to the die hole in a state in which the punch is opposed to the die hole of the die, to move the punch in and out of the die hole.
